Martin Park Nature Center in North Oklahoma City is a wonderful place to try your eye for nature photography. During my walk there, I spotted people using the park features for engagement photography, family fall pictures, and even professional videography.

★★★★★ — Honorata , Nov 2025

It's such a beautiful park area in the middle of the city. It's a tiny escape into nature. The trail is very easy. The visitor center was a fun, hands-on, and observational learning area. The staff was knowledgeable and passionate about teaching visitors. We loved this place.

★★★★★ — Danielle , Dec 2025

I had an amazing time at Martin Park Nature Center! The park is absolutely beautiful with plenty of trees, so you can enjoy a nice, shaded walk. My friends and I had a wonderful time strolling through the trails and taking in the sights of deer, birds, and even some turtles.

★★★★★ — Lady , Jun 2025

Great place nestled right in a residential area. There’s a nice nature walk area with a little body of water that’s fun to watch the birds. The trail is super kept up and there is plenty of seating at the beginning of the trail. Pretty accessible too, and there wasn’t anything blocking the pathways.
